Home
last modified time | relevance | path

Searched refs:call_idx (Results 1 - 3 of 3) sorted by relevance

/third_party/mesa3d/src/compiler/nir/
H A Dnir_lower_shader_calls.c354 unsigned call_idx = 0; in spill_ssa_defs_and_lower_shader_calls() local
360 call_block_indices[call_idx] = block->index; in spill_ssa_defs_and_lower_shader_calls()
370 call_live[call_idx] = in spill_ssa_defs_and_lower_shader_calls()
373 call_idx++; in spill_ssa_defs_and_lower_shader_calls()
381 call_idx = 0; in spill_ssa_defs_and_lower_shader_calls()
397 const BITSET_WORD *live = call_live[call_idx]; in spill_ssa_defs_and_lower_shader_calls()
459 fill_defs[index][call_idx] = def; in spill_ssa_defs_and_lower_shader_calls()
482 .call_idx = call_idx, .stack_size = offset); in spill_ssa_defs_and_lower_shader_calls()
490 nir_rt_execute_callable(b, call->src[0].ssa, call->src[1].ssa, .call_idx in spill_ssa_defs_and_lower_shader_calls()
610 find_resume_instr(nir_function_impl *impl, unsigned call_idx) find_resume_instr() argument
1040 lower_resume(nir_shader *shader, int call_idx) lower_resume() argument
[all...]
/third_party/mesa3d/src/intel/compiler/
H A Dbrw_nir_lower_shader_calls.c127 uint32_t call_idx = nir_intrinsic_call_idx(call); in store_resume_addr() local
135 call_idx * BRW_BTD_RESUME_SBT_STRIDE); in store_resume_addr()
/third_party/mesa3d/src/amd/vulkan/
H A Dradv_pipeline_rt.c731 uint32_t call_idx_base, uint32_t call_idx) in insert_rt_case()
748 nir_push_if(b, nir_ieq_imm(b, idx, call_idx)); in insert_rt_case()
730 insert_rt_case(nir_builder *b, nir_shader *shader, struct rt_variables *vars, nir_ssa_def *idx, uint32_t call_idx_base, uint32_t call_idx) insert_rt_case() argument

Completed in 6 milliseconds